One of a series, this book shows children how to make and perform magic tricks and how to present a magic show in their own home. All tricks and props are made from everyday materials. The book includes step-by-step photographs and simple instructions. Speech boxes suggest the patter to be used and there are tips on sleight-of-hand and rehearsal.
